A member asked:

I wear contacts that are -1.25 because i have trouble seeing faces/things clearly when they are 10+ feet away. but, 3/4 of my workday is working on a computer screen that is close up. am i making my eyes worse by wearing my contacts all day?

2 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

It is unlikely that wearing contacts is making your eyes worse. It would help to look away from the screen, even for a few seconds, every 10-15 minutes. If you have other symptoms, it would be prudent to consult an ophthalmologist. Wish you good health!

At age 22 there is a large amount of focusing ability so eye strain from doing computer work all day should not be a problem. However, if you do not wear the contacts, you would not have to focus much at all because of your natural nearsightedness. Either option is fine. One disadvantage of lens use is that long term computer use may be drying to the eyes, so you could consider using OTC tears.
